Brown-Driver-Briggs Expanded Definition
נַעֲמִי adjective, of a people from IIנַעֲמָן
1, Numbers 26:40, read doubtless נעמני (so ⅏).

Gesenius' Hebrew and Chaldee Definition
נַעֲמִי [Naamites], patron. of the pr.n. נַעֲמָן No. 2, b, for נַעֲמָנִי (which is found in the Samaritan copy), Numbers 26:40.
